Critical Admission Temperature of H<sub>2</sub> and CH<sub>4</sub> in Nanopores of Exchanged ERI Zeolites
Due to the nanoporous nature of zeolitic materials, they can be used as gas adsorbents. This paper describes the effect of critical admission temperature through narrow pores of natural ERI zeolites at low levels of coverage. This phenomenon occurs by adsorption of CH<sub>4</sub> and H&l...
